I don't know about your question. If we forested the square and placed a unit on there then would it:

Need one omvement point from an amphibious unit to kill our unit, followed by two movement points from the attacking unita and two movement points from every other unit to land?

I know it takes one movement point for us to land anything. Remember it takes one movement point to land a probe on the river near the Uni base we've been probing plus 2/3 of a movement up the river to get next to the base.

I remember from SP games I would often place a rover on a transport and pop pods in the fungus coastlines. It would take one rover move to land the rover (which would also pop the pod) and one rover move to get the rover back on the transport the same turn. this was very handy when the rover popped mindworms. If there is a road in the fungus (or forest) then I think the rover could move elsewhere (other than back to the transport) using up only 1/3 turn. If there was no road then it would be required to use up whatever it takes to get through forest or fungus.

I can confirm that landing from a boat is always one movement point, even on fungus.

We could station probes outside of bases, near coastal bases, so they wouldn't know where they are, and would have difficulty planning probe defense.

One possibility is to have roads connecting adjacent coastal cities, connected by roads, with probes hanging out on the roads. The probes might have a chance to retake quickly. Core cities wouldn't be as vulnerable because the roads don't lead in, only around.
